The Pennant Group, Inc. (NASDAQ: PNTG) is capturing the attention of individual investors, particularly those with an interest in the healthcare sector. With its current market position and significant growth potential, this healthcare services provider presents a compelling opportunity. Headquartered in Eagle, Idaho, The Pennant Group operates a diverse portfolio across the United States, focusing on Home Health and Hospice Services, alongside Senior Living Services.

Currently trading at $29.23, The Pennant Group’s stock price sits comfortably within its 52-week range of $22.07 to $30.22. Investors are keenly eyeing the stock, as analysts have set a target price range between $31.00 and $40.00, indicating a potential upside of 24.30%. This potential is underscored by a consensus of seven buy ratings, with no holds or sells, suggesting a strong market confidence in the company’s future performance.

A standout feature of The Pennant Group is its robust revenue growth of 26.80%, a clear indicator of its expanding market influence and operational effectiveness. With an EPS of 0.75 and a Return on Equity (ROE) of 11.28%, the company demonstrates a healthy balance between profitability and shareholder returns. Furthermore, the company maintains a free cash flow of approximately $23.28 million, positioning itself well for strategic investments and operational expansions.

Despite the strong growth metrics, The Pennant Group’s valuation metrics present a mixed picture. The absence of a trailing P/E ratio, PEG ratio, and price-to-sales ratio may initially deter some investors. However, the forward P/E ratio of 22.29 suggests that the market anticipates continued earnings growth, reflecting optimism about the company’s future profitability.

Technically, The Pennant Group’s stock is also attractive. The 50-day and 200-day moving averages are $26.95 and $26.05 respectively, suggesting a bullish trend.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) stands at 58.92, indicating neither overbought nor oversold conditions, while the MACD and Signal Line further support a positive price momentum.

Unlike many of its peers, The Pennant Group does not currently offer a dividend, maintaining a payout ratio of 0.00%. This suggests a strategic reinvestment of earnings into the business, potentially fueling further growth and expansion of its healthcare services.

The Pennant Group’s operations extend across a broad geographical footprint, including states such as Arizona, California, and Texas. The company’s dual focus on home health and senior living services provides a diversified revenue stream and a hedge against sector-specific downturns. This diversity, coupled with a strategic focus on quality care and expanding service offerings, positions The Pennant Group as a formidable player in the healthcare industry.
